WebDec 8, 2024 · Buenos Aires, Argentina. I think diffusion is the way to go for the wall behind you speakers, and absorption on the side walls and the wall behind the listening position. If you have a high ceiling, diffusion works wonders there too. The farther you listen to diffusion panels, the better the effect.

WebSep 28, 2010 · High frequencies from your speakers will be quite directional, so you won't get significant first reflections from that wall, only after reflecting off other walls first. WebAug 20, 2008 · For subs running below 100 Hz, none is necessary. In theory, no, but in practice subwoofers generate harmonics that must be damped, lest they reflect back to the cone or out a port. The exception is folded horn subs, which filter the harmonics out in the bends of the horn. WebJan 28, 2008 · Consider installing some insulation (R-13) in the wall cavity behind the speakers to improve sound quality. The width of the insulation is usually pre-cut, so you only need to cut it to length and insert it in the opening behind the speakers. WebApr 13, 2016 · Most people just use fiberglass batting behind ceiling and wall mount speakers (also recommended by most speaker manufacturers). You can go above an beyond and try and use some sort of acoustic panels / foam etc but not sure you'll acquire any incremental benefit.
